What this is, in one paragraph

Jellyfin's SyncPlay drifts because group members end up on different transcode/direct-play paths and the correction mechanism is weak. This plugin does three things: (1) picks one quality profile the whole group can use, (2) relays one member's ("host") already-transcoding stream to the rest of the group instead of spinning up N independent transcode jobs, (3) runs an active drift-correction loop on top (virtual playhead + NTP-style clock calibration + heartbeat/EMA drift measurement + speed-nudge-or-hard-reseek).
